> One windows excell page mentions that it uses the
> banking rounding method, which I believe is the round to
> nearest even. So, using that method 12.125 would round
> to 12.12, while 12.135 would round to 12.14..

> With this method if next digit is 1,2,3,4 the number
> rounds down. If it is 6,7,8,9 it rounds up. If 0 it does
> nothing, but if it is 5, it has to check if the key pervious
> digit is an even or old number. If it is even, then it rounds
> down, if odd it rounds up.
>
> The regular LibreOffice round uses the standard round
> function.
>
> Usually, the standard round is used, but know that some
> government regulations require the banking/roundeven
> or roundodd method.

> > Meanwhile, you can make your own function that you can use. Here are two
> > different suggestions.
> >
> > 1: This one use the Calc built-in ROUND() cell function. Place it in "My
> > macros & dialogs". VBA compatibility mode is not needed.
> >
> > Public Function faRound(x As Double, d As Integer)
> > Dim Calc
> > Calc=createUnoService("com.sun.star.sheet.FunctionAccess")
> > faRound=Calc.callFunction("ROUND", Array(x, d))
> > End Function
> >
> > 2: This one use the method we learned at school:
> > Public Function fRound(x As Double, d As Integer)
> > fRound=Int(10^d*x+.5)/10^d
> > End Function
> >
> > Test:
> > Print afRound(12.125, 2)
> > Result: 12.13
> >
> > Print fRound(12.125, 2)
> > Result: 12.13
> >
> > Print fRound(12.125, 1)
> > Result: 12.1
> >
> > ... and so on.

> > > I have just put a basic macro together so it will calculate income tax
> > > due from our local tax rates.
> > > I needed to round the tax to the nearest cent so taking the easy route
> I
> > > added Option VBASupport 1 to use the available VB round function.
> > >
> > > I then noticed that the VB round function with say round(12.125,2)
> > > rounds down to 12.12 and the LO inbuilt spread sheet function ROUND
> with
> > > ROUND(12.125,2) rounds up to 12.13.
> > >
> > > Is rounding in this situation arbitrary or is there some some
> convention
> > > for consistency.
